Hiroki Ito is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Hiroki Ito has authored 44 papers receiving a total of 784 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Epidemiology, 17 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 15 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Hiroki Ito's work include Congenital Heart Disease Studies (20 papers), Tracheal and airway disorders (11 papers) and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(8 papers). Hiroki Ito is often cited by papers focused on Congenital Heart Disease Studies (20 papers), Tracheal and airway disorders (11 papers) and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(8 papers). Hiroki Ito collaborates with scholars based in Japan and United States. Hiroki Ito's co-authors include Gen Sobue, Masaaki Hirayama, Keiko Mori, Haruki Koike, Naoki Hattori, Masahiro Iijima, Irwin J. Schatz, Kevin L. Tay, Todd B. Seto and Khung Keong Yeo and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Annals of Neurology and Scientific Reports.
